Adm. Mullen in Pakistan to ease tensions
Reports say that Adm Michael Mullen has come to Islamabad to ease tensions created fatally reckless raids conducted by American forces in the tribal areas.
Pakistan has made it clear it would repulse future raids. Pakistani Army believes that raids will increase sympathies for Taliban in the tribal. They will get help and logistical support from tribemen. This will make Pakistan Army’s work difficult.
